Pelé, Maradona, Messi, Ronaldinho, Zidane
The number 10 is football's most sacred shirt. Given to the creator, the playmaker, the genius. Every generation has a 10 who defines it.
Cristiano Ronaldo, Beckham, Cantona, Best, Figo
At Manchester United, 7 is a legacy. From Best to Beckham to Ronaldo, it carries weight. At Real Madrid, Raúl made it iconic.
Ronaldo (R9), Lewandowski, Suárez, Van Basten, Shearer
The striker's number. R9 defined it in the late 90s. Shearer owned it in England. The 9 scores goals — that's the only requirement.
Beckenbauer, Zidane, Puyol, Cannavaro
In football, the 5 is the leader. Beckenbauer reinvented the position. Puyol embodied it. The captain's number in many traditions.
